About this app

Rare Candy - Scan, Track, and Rip Packs Rare Candy is built for TCG collectors who want one place to scan cards, track value, open Instapacks, and shop verified listings. Scan Pokémon, Magic: The Gathering, One Piece, Disney Lorcana, Gundam, and graded slabs. Build binders, follow market movement, spot grading upside, and open curated Instapacks that reveal real cards you can keep, ship, or exchange for candy. SCAN CARDS Identify raw and graded cards with your camera. Rare Candy supports English and Japanese Pokémon sets, plus Magic: The Gathering, One Piece, Lorcana, Gundam, Riftbound, and slabs from PSA, CGC, BGS, SGC, and TAG. TRACK YOUR COLLECTION Organize everything you own in digital binders. See master set progress, manage wishlists, and keep your collection updated as you scan.
